Phase II Study of Irinotecan Plus Cisplatin Induction Followed by Concurrent Twice-Daily Thoracic Irradiation With Etoposide Plus Cisplatin Chemotherapy for Limited-Disease Small-Cell Lung Cancer

Ji-Youn Han, Kwan Ho Cho, Dae Ho Lee, Hyae Young Kim, Eun-A Kim, Sung Young Lee, Jin Soo Lee

From the Research Institute & Hospital, National Cancer Center, Goyang, Gyeonggi, Korea

Address reprint requests to Jin Soo Lee, MD, Center for Lung Cancer, National Cancer Center, 809 Madu1-dong, Ilsan-gu, Goyang-si, Gyeonggi-do, 411-764, Korea; e-mail: jslee{at}ncc.re.kr

PURPOSE: Irinotecan plus cisplatin (IP) chemotherapy demonstrated a promising outcome with a high complete response (CR) rate in chemotherapy-naïve patients with extensive small-cell lung cancer (SCLC). We evaluated the efficacy of induction IP chemotherapy followed by concurrent etoposide plus cisplatin (EP) chemotherapy with twice-daily thoracic radiotherapy (TDTRT) in limited-disease SCLC (LD-SCLC).

PATIENTS AND METHODS: Between November 2001 and May 2003, 35 chemotherapy-naïve patients with LD-SCLC were enrolled. Thirty-three patients (94%) were male, and 29 (83%) had an Eastern Cooperative Oncology Group performance status of 0 or 1. The median age was 63 years. Treatment consisted of two 21-day cycles of cisplatin 40 mg/m2 and irinotecan 80 mg/m2 intravenously (IV) on days 1 and 8 followed by two 21-day cycles of cisplatin 60 mg/m2 IV on days 43 and 64, and etoposide 100 mg/m2 IV on days 43 to 45 and 64 to 66, with concurrent TDTRT of total 45 Gy beginning on day 43.

RESULTS: All 35 patients were assessable for response. The objective response rate was 97% (CR, 3; partial response [PR], 31) after induction chemotherapy and 100% (CR, 15; PR, 20) after concurrent chemoradiotherapy (CCRT). After a median follow-up of 26.5 months, the median survival was 25.0 months (95% CI, 19.0 to 30.9) with 1- and 2-year overall survival rates of 85.7% and 53.9%, respectively. Median progression-free survival (PFS) was 12.9 months with a 1- and 2-year PFS of 58.5% and 36.1%, respectively. The most common toxicities were grade 3 or 4 neutropenia in 68% of patients during induction chemotherapy and 100% during CCRT. Febrile neutropenia occurred in 20% of patients during induction chemotherapy and 60% during CCRT.

CONCLUSION: IP induction chemotherapy followed by concurrent TDTRT with EP chemotherapy showed a promising activity with favorable 1- and 2-year survival rates. Based on the favorable outcome in this trial, this regimen should be evaluated in a large phase III trial.
